Well, you don't have to convince me. Switch is currently my primary gaming platform, my Linux-PC my secondary. And my backlog is ever increasing.

But there are some reasons why Switch might not be enough.

1. You like big action games, shooters or sports games. Without a doubt the Switch is bad in these categories, although it looks a bit better in the action department, but still there is much more on the other consoles. If you on the other hand like instead adventures, metroidvania or platformers the Switch is obviously better than any other platforms. For me I don't have any interest in Sports games, get enough action games on Switch and have only occasional urge for shooters which Doom satisfies well enough.

2. You like extraordinarily one of the exclusives on other platforms or a multiplat that is missing the Switch. This is usually the main argument to own a Nintendo console, but it works as well for the other consoles. Who wants Red Dead Redemption 2 is not looking fondly on the Switch. For me personally - my taste in games is stuck somewhat back in the past, I didn't follow modern trends. So I don't care much for most of the games. I kinda miss out on Witcher 3, but basically that urge can be satisfied enough with games like Zelda. Other than that nothing really speaks to me which is missing Switch. Yeah, if I had RDR2 I would give it a try, but I don't care too much. I tried GTAV because everyone was so into that, and it bored me to death. So I'm not too hot on another Rockstar game.

3. You might look down on Nintendo games, indies and genres besides the action and shooter stuff. Therefore Civ VI (which is a big deal for me personally) does nothing for you, you scoff at Undertale and Hollow Knight and Mario looks silly and childish. As I'm one of the older gamers, I'm over these stuff. I like games that entertain me. Does the game look silly or childish? I don't care, I'm sure enough of my adulthood, that I can admit that Eevee is totally cute and I just enjoy leaving the start screen of Let's Go on for a few seconds to enjoy how Eevee jumps around without a care in the world. Yeah, as a teenager I too was anxious to look mature. But I got over it. Same with indies. I don't need the validation of the peer group to play the same game as everyone. I can pick up a total indie game and enjoy the hell out of it.

4. You don't have to work or generally more than enough time so that you constantly need new games to be entertained. Probably most consoles don't work for you alone, but maybe a console with more and bigger games take precedence over the Switch then. I have work and also have other interests like movies and books, so my gaming time is restricted. I also like to play slow and take my time in games. Therefore I don't get through games that fast.
